A Graduate Certificate in Humanitarian Shelter and Settlement Design provides specialized training in the design and implementation of emergency shelters and resilient settlements for displaced populations. This intensive program equips professionals with the necessary skills to address complex challenges in humanitarian crises.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ering appropriate design methodologies for temporary and transitional shelters, understanding disaster risk reduction strategies, and developing sustainable settlement planning approaches. Students will also gain proficiency in using appropriate technologies and materials for construction in diverse contexts, encompassing both humanitarian aid and sustainable development principles.
The duration of such a certificate program varies, but generally ranges from several months to a year, often delivered through a combination of online and on-site modules, flexible learning options accommodating working professionals' schedules. Successful completion often leads to a valuable credential recognized by humanitarian organizations and development agencies.
This Graduate Certificate is highly relevant to various sectors. Graduates are well-prepared for roles in NGOs, international organizations like UNHCR or the ICRC, government agencies involved in disaster response, and private sector firms specializing in humanitarian engineering or sustainable building solutions. The skills gained are directly applicable to refugee camps, post-disaster reconstruction, and community development projects worldwide. Graduates can expect to contribute to improved living conditions, enhanced safety, and increased resilience of affected populations. Job prospects include shelter coordinator, camp manager, and settlement planner positions.
The program emphasizes practical application, often incorporating fieldwork, case studies, and simulations to prepare students for real-world challenges in the humanitarian sector. Community engagement, participatory design, and cultural sensitivity are integrated throughout the curriculum of this Graduate Certificate in Humanitarian Shelter and Settlement Design.
